Olympic Champion Duncan Scott Is First Swimmer Selected For 2026 Commonwealth Games

By Retta Race on SwimSwam

Based on his performance as a member of the British men’s 4x200m free relay at this year’s World Championships, Olympic champion Duncan Scott is officially the first swimmer selected for the 2026 Commonwealth Games.

    Next year’s edition of the quadrennial event returns to Glasgow, the same city which hosted the elite multi-sport competition in 2014, where now-28-year-old Scott made his debut.

    In that edition, he collected silver in the men’s 4x200m free relay but has since accumulated an additional 12 pieces of hardware over the course of the 2018 Gold Coast and 2022 Birmingham Games.

    Scotland’s most decorated Commonwealth Games athlete in history said recently, “To think my first-ever Commonwealth Games was in 2014 and for the Games to be Glasgow for 2026 is pretty special. The momentum is really starting to build, and the Games are coming round fast.

    “I have fond memories of 2014; the way the country got behind all the athletes, and how Team Scotland responded to that in terms of success.

    “The Scottish fans always bring something different, and with the Commonwealth Games coming back to Glasgow next year, hopefully they will bring the excitement once again.” (Stirling)

    “I love that we are all part of a team where everyone has a different Everest,” Scott told BBC Sport Scotland.

    “Some just want to be there, some want to reach a final, others are looking for a medal, and some are big-name Olympians and I love that disparity.

    “In Team GB, it’s all about the elite, but in Team Scotland we’ve all grown up together in the sport and know each other’s journeys and are really invested in each other being successful, in whatever form that takes.

    “Each person’s goal is just as important to everyone else – and I love that.”

    Elinor Middlemiss, Team Scotland Chef de Mission, said: “We are delighted to welcome Duncan back to the team for Glasgow 2026.

    “Duncan’s successes with both Team Scotland and Team GB have been truly inspirational and we look forward to the next chapter in Glasgow next summer, the city where he won his very first medal with Team Scotland.

    “Athletes of the calibre of Duncan and the three athletics team members named so far are spearheading our selections at this early stage from what is already shaping up to be a strong team.” (Stirling)
